Top 10 EY Data Analyst Interview Questions + Guide in 2024

Top 10 EY Data Analyst Interview Questions + Guide in 2024

Overview

Ernst & Young (EY) is a global leader in assurance, consulting, strategy and transactions, tax, and law services. With a workforce spanning over 150 countries, EY helps build trust and assurance in the capital markets, enabling client growth and transformation.

If you’re considering a role at EY, this guide on Interview Query will walk you through the interview process, typical EY data analyst interview questions, and preparation tips. Let’s dive in!

Cultural and Behavioral Questions

This feature is currently experimental, and we’re committed to improving it with your valuable feedback.

Can you describe a time when you encountered a particularly challenging dataset? What specific problems did you face, and how did you go about resolving them? Please detail your approach to data cleaning, analysis, and any tools you used.

When addressing a challenging dataset, it's essential to highlight your problem-solving skills and analytical thinking. Start by describing the dataset, including its size, complexity, and the specific issues encountered, such as missing values or inconsistencies. Then, outline the strategies you employed to clean and preprocess the data—this could include using tools like Python or R for data manipulation, as well as any relevant libraries (e.g., Pandas, NumPy). Finally, discuss how you validated your results and the impact of your analysis on the project or business decision, showcasing your ability to turn challenges into insights.

Tell me about a situation where you had stakeholders who disagreed with your data analysis findings. How did you handle their objections, and what steps did you take to ensure everyone was aligned?

In such situations, it's crucial to maintain open communication and foster collaboration. Start by explaining the context of the disagreement, such as differing priorities or interpretations of the data. Describe how you approached the stakeholders—perhaps through a meeting to present your findings visually, using charts or dashboards to clarify your points. Discuss how you actively listened to their concerns, incorporated their feedback into your analysis, and facilitated a constructive dialogue. Conclude by reflecting on the outcome, emphasizing how your efforts led to a consensus and improved stakeholder relationships.

Provide an example of a time you identified a process within data management that needed improvement. What was the process, and how did you implement changes to enhance its efficiency?

When discussing process improvements, focus on your analytical skills and initiative. Begin by describing the existing process and the inefficiencies you observed, whether it was slow data retrieval or cumbersome reporting methods. Share the steps you took to analyze the process, such as mapping workflows or gathering feedback from team members. Highlight the solutions you proposed and implemented, detailing any new tools, automation, or best practices you introduced. Finally, discuss the impact of these changes, quantifying improvements when possible (e.g., reduced report generation time by 30%) and demonstrating your commitment to continuous improvement.

EY Data Analyst Interview Process

The interview process usually depends on the role and seniority. However, you can expect the following on an EY data analyst interview:

Recruiter/Hiring Manager Call Screening

If your CV is among the shortlisted few, a recruiter from the EY Talent Acquisition Team will contact you and verify key details like your experiences and skill level. Behavioral questions may also be part of the screening process.

Sometimes, the EY hiring manager stays present during the screening round to answer your queries about the role and the company itself. They may also indulge in surface-level technical and behavioral discussions.

The whole recruiter call should take about 30 minutes.

Technical Virtual Interview

Successfully navigating the recruiter round will invite you to the technical screening round. Technical screening for the EY data analyst role is usually conducted through virtual means, including video conference and screen sharing. Questions in this one-hour interview stage may revolve around data systems, ETL pipelines, and SQL queries.

In the case of data analyst roles, take-home assignments regarding product metrics, analytics, and data visualization are incorporated. In addition, your proficiency in hypothesis testing, probability distributions, and machine learning fundamentals may also be assessed during the round.

Case studies and similar real-scenario problems may also be assigned depending on the position’s seniority.

Onsite Interview Rounds

Followed by a second recruiter call outlining the next stage, you’ll be invited to attend the onsite interview loop. Multiple interview rounds will be conducted during your day at the EY office, varying with the role. Your technical prowess, including programming and ML modeling capabilities, will be evaluated against the finalized candidates throughout these interviews.

If you were assigned take-home exercises, a presentation round may also await you during the onsite interview for the data analyst role at EY.

Never Get Stuck with an Interview Question Again

What Questions Are Asked in an EY Data Analyst Interview?

Typically, interviews at EY vary by role and team, but commonly, Data Analyst interviews follow a fairly standardized process across these question topics.

1. What kind of analysis would you conduct to recommend changes to the UI?

You have access to tables summarizing user event data for a community forum app. Conduct a user journey analysis using this data to recommend changes to the user interface.

2. How would you assess the validity of the result in an AB test with a .04 p-value?

Your company is running a standard control and variant AB test on a feature to increase conversion rates on the landing page. The PM finds a .04 p-value. Assess the validity of this result.

3. How would you debug and improve the efficiency of a slow SQL query?

You are running a SQL query that is taking a long time. Determine how to know if it’s taking too long and how to debug the issue to improve efficiency.

4. How would you determine how much Spotify should pay for an ad in a third-party app?

As a data scientist on the marketing team for Spotify, determine how much Spotify should pay for an ad in a third-party app.

5. Write a SQL query to select the 2nd highest salary in the engineering department.

Note: If more than one person shares the highest salary, the query should select the next highest salary.

Example:

Input:

employees table

Column Type
id INTEGER
first_name VARCHAR
last_name VARCHAR
salary INTEGER
department_id INTEGER

departments table

Column Type
id INTEGER
name VARCHAR

Output:

Column Type
salary INTEGER

6. How can PG&E model the electricity supply needed for a town?

PG&E needs to forecast the exact amount of electricity to supply a town each year. Supplying too little causes outages, while supplying too much wastes money. What is one way to model the required electricity supply?

7. How do sentiment analysis models convert raw text data into numerical vectors and get trained?

To perform sentiment analysis on an Amazon customer feedback dataset, you need to convert raw text into numerical vectors. Explain how these models work and how they are trained.

8. How would you assess the effectiveness of a clustering model for grouping basketball players without pre-labeled data?

You are hired by the LA Lakers to scout potential players and group them based on their strengths and weaknesses. After training a clustering model, how would you evaluate if it successfully grouped similar players without having pre-labeled data?

9. Write a query that returns all neighborhoods that have 0 users.

We’re given two tables, a users table with demographic information and the neighborhood they live in and a neighborhoods table.

10. Given a table of bank transactions with columns id, transaction_value, and created_at representing the date and time for each transaction, write a query to get the last transaction for each day.

The output should include the id of the transaction, datetime of the transaction, and the transaction amount. Order the transactions by date time.

How to Prepare for a Data Analyst Interview at EY

You should plan to brush up on any technical skills and try as many practice interview questions and mock interviews as possible. A few tips for acing your EY data analyst interview include:

  • Understand EY’s Core Values: EY values high ethical standards and integrity. Be sure to convey through your responses how you align with these core values.
  • Be Data Driven: EY interviews focus heavily on how well you can provide business-driving insights with data. Brush up on your knowledge of statistics, probability, and SQL.
  • Articulate Your Problem-Solving Approach: Showcase your ability to approach and solve problems systematically. Practice explaining your thought process clearly and logically.

FAQs

What is the average salary for a Data Analyst at EY?

$114,362

Average Base Salary

$78,698

Average Total Compensation

Min: $58K
Max: $207K
Base Salary
Median: $102K
Mean (Average): $114K
Data points: 2,051
Min: $3K
Max: $139K
Total Compensation
Median: $83K
Mean (Average): $79K
Data points: 16

View the full Data Analyst at Ey salary guide

What kind of technical skills are essential for a Data Analyst role at EY?

To excel in this role, you should be proficient in SQL, Python, and data visualization tools like Power BI or Tableau. Experience with data governance frameworks and familiarity with platforms like AWS or Azure can also be beneficial.

What does EY look for in its candidates?

EY values candidates who demonstrate high ethical standards, integrity, and a strong commitment to the company’s values. Additionally, they look for individuals with excellent technical skills, strong problem-solving abilities, and the ability to work effectively in diverse and collaborative environments.

What makes working at EY unique?

EY offers a unique combination of global scale, supportive and inclusive culture, and cutting-edge technology. The company encourages continuous learning and provides opportunities for personal and professional growth. At EY, you’ll have the chance to build a meaningful career while contributing to a better working world.

Never Get Stuck with an Interview Question Again

Conclusion

If you’re aiming for a Data Analyst position at EY, you’ll encounter an interview process that includes technical assessments and behavioral interviews, all tailored to assess your analytical prowess, IT skills, and alignment with EY’s cultural values.

For a more comprehensive understanding of the interview process, check out our main EY Interview Guide, where we cover various questions that you may encounter. We’ve also crafted detailed guides for different roles such as software engineer and data analyst, providing insights into EY’s specific requirements and expectations.

Good luck with your interview!